Best Time to Visit Costa Rica for Your Honeymoon
For sunny days and little to no rain, the dry season from December to April is perfect — with comfortable highs between 74°F and 79°F. This is peak season, so expect more travelers, but also the best beach weather.
If you prefer fewer crowds, lower prices, and a greener, more vibrant landscape, consider the green season from May to November. While you may see occasional showers, they often pass quickly — and on the Caribbean coast, you’ll even find sunny days in September when the Pacific side is wet.
No matter when you go, Costa Rica’s tropical climate means a little rain is always possible — but that’s part of what keeps its rainforests so lush and magical.

Udaipur Honeymoon Highlights
It’s impossible not to fall in love with Udaipur’s shimmering lakes and grand palaces. Start with the City Palace, an architectural masterpiece perched on the banks of Lake Pichola. Entry costs around ₹300 for Indian visitors and ₹700 for international travelers — a small price for the sweeping views and royal history inside. For a different perspective, head up to the Monsoon Palace (Sajjangarh), where panoramic views of the city await. Entry is roughly ₹60 per person plus ₹200 per vehicle.
When it comes to accommodations, Udaipur is a dream for honeymooners. Picture waking up to lake views at Taj Lake Palace or The Leela Palace, both famous for their romantic setting and exceptional service. On average, luxury hotels here cost around ₹13,332 per night, but the experience is worth every rupee for couples seeking that extra touch of magic.

Best Time to Visit Udaipur for Your Honeymoon
The sweet spot for a honeymoon in Udaipur is October to March, when the weather is comfortably cool, ranging from 12°C to 25°C (54°F to 77°F). These winter months are perfect for sightseeing, boat rides, and lakeside strolls.
If you’re looking for fewer crowds and greener surroundings, July to September (monsoon season) offers a unique charm — plus better hotel rates — though you may have to plan around occasional showers. Summer (April to June) brings intense heat up to 45°C (113°F), making it less ideal for romantic escapes.
For the perfect mix of comfort, beauty, and romance, winter in Udaipur is hard to beat.

Why Cappadocia is Perfect for Honeymooners
Cappadocia’s landscape is like another planet — tall, cone-shaped rock formations (called fairy chimneys) stretch across the valleys, and soft volcanic rock has been carved into cozy cave homes for centuries.
One of the most charming parts of a honeymoon here is staying in a luxury cave hotel. These unique accommodations blend ancient history with modern comfort — think stone walls, warm lighting, and private terraces with breathtaking views.
Couples can also explore Goreme Open-Air Museum, a UNESCO World Heritage Site where ancient churches and monasteries are carved into the rock, decorated with beautiful frescoes dating back to the Middle Ages.

2. Horseback Riding Through the Valleys
Nicknamed the “Land of Beautiful Horses,” Cappadocia is perfect for couples who love a bit of adventure. Riding through the scenic valleys lets you enjoy the peaceful landscapes away from the crowds.
3. Wine Tasting at Ancient Vineyards
Wine lovers will adore Cappadocia’s vineyards. Winemaking here goes back over 7,000 years, and you can sample local varieties while enjoying stunning views.
4. Exploring Underground Cities
The underground cities of Derinkuyu and Kaymakli are fascinating to explore. These multi-level ancient settlements once sheltered thousands of people, complete with kitchens, storage rooms, and even stables.
Best Time to Visit Cappadocia for Your Honeymoon
-
Spring (March–May) and Autumn (September–November) are the best seasons — mild weather, fewer crowds, and gorgeous scenery.
-
Summer (June–August) is warmer (up to 90°F) and more crowded, but still popular for its clear skies.
-
Winter (December–February) turns Cappadocia into a snowy wonderland. It’s quieter, cheaper, and perfect for couples wanting a cozy, intimate escape.

Romantic Things to Do in Buenos Aires
1. Learn the Tango Together
As the birthplace of tango, Buenos Aires is the perfect place to connect through this passionate dance. Book a private tango lesson and feel the rhythm of the city in every step.
2. Enjoy an Intimate Tango Show
For an unforgettable evening, visit Viejo Almacén in San Telmo. This legendary venue offers an intimate tango performance, complete with moody lighting and an authentic atmosphere.
3. Stroll Through the Rose Garden
The Bosques de Palermo rose garden is a peaceful, romantic escape featuring more than 18,000 blooming roses—ideal for a leisurely hand-in-hand walk.
4. Sunset Drinks with a View
Head to Sky Bar on the 13th floor of the Pulitzer Hotel for panoramic city views and a perfectly mixed cocktail as the sun dips below the skyline.
Best Time to Visit Buenos Aires for a Honeymoon
-
Spring (September–November) – The most romantic season with mild, sunny weather (60s–70s°F) and blooming jacaranda trees.
-
Fall (March–May) – Another beautiful season with pleasant temperatures, fewer tourists, and rich autumn colors.
Tip: Remember that Argentina is in the Southern Hemisphere, so seasons are opposite to those in North America and Europe.

Queenstown Honeymoon Highlights
Queenstown’s alpine scenery is nothing short of cinematic. Towering mountains reflect in the crystal-clear lake, and every corner feels like a postcard.
Known as New Zealand’s adventure capital, this charming resort town gives couples a chance to experience bungee jumping, skydiving, jet boating, and more. But it’s not all adrenaline — you can also enjoy peaceful moments soaking in the stillness of the lake, sipping wine in mountain lodges, or wandering along scenic trails.
What makes Queenstown even better? Its prime location allows easy day trips to stunning spots like Milford Sound, Fiordland National Park, and Glenorchy — all within a few hours’ drive.
Romantic Things to Do in Queenstown
1. Sunset Cruise on the TSS Earnslaw
Step aboard the TSS Earnslaw, a vintage steamship that’s been sailing Lake Wakatipu for over 110 years. Sip champagne as the sun sets over the mountains — a scene you’ll never forget.
2. Onsen Hot Pools with Mountain Views
Relax in a private cedar hot tub overlooking the Shotover River. These world-famous hot pools are incredibly popular, so book early to secure your romantic soak.
3. Gondola Ride to Bob’s Peak
Glide up the Skyline Gondola for breathtaking panoramic views of Queenstown and the Remarkables mountain range.
4. Scenic Helicopter Flight
Take your love to new heights with a helicopter ride over Fiordland National Park, where you’ll see glaciers, waterfalls, and dramatic peaks from above.
5. Lakeside Strolls & Vineyard Visits
Enjoy leisurely walks along Lake Wakatipu or visit nearby Central Otago wineries for tastings in picture-perfect settings.

Bukhara Honeymoon Highlights
Nestled on an ancient oasis in Central Asia, Bukhara is like stepping into a living museum. Its medieval city center, recognized as a UNESCO World Heritage Site, is one of the best-preserved in the region — a maze of mosques, madrasahs, and bazaars that radiate old-world romance.
Couples are instantly captivated by the Poi-Kalyan Complex, home to the 1,000-year-old Kalyan Minaret, which glows beautifully when lit up at night — a picture-perfect backdrop for honeymoon photos. As you wander, you’ll also discover the elegant Lyabi-Khauz Ensemble and historic trading domes, once bustling markets where Silk Road merchants traded treasures from around the world.
Romantic Things to Do in Bukhara
1. Sunset at the Ark of Bukhara
Climb to this 5th-century fortress for panoramic views of the old city bathed in golden sunset light — a magical moment to share with your partner.
2. Evening Stroll by Lyabi Hauz Pool
Hand in hand, wander through the tranquil courtyards surrounding the pool. At night, the softly illuminated buildings create an enchanting, fairy-tale setting.
3. Dinner with a View
Book a table at Chashmai Mirob or other rooftop restaurants for romantic dining with sweeping views over Bukhara’s skyline.
4. Explore the Silk Road Heritage
Lose yourselves in Bukhara’s winding streets, visiting ancient caravanserais, ornate madrasahs, and vibrant markets where time feels frozen.

Prague Honeymoon Highlights
Imagine strolling through cobbled streets lined with medieval buildings, grand churches, and charming cafés. At the heart of the city lies Prague Castle, a UNESCO World Heritage Site that houses the Crown Jewels and relics of Bohemian kings. From hilltop views to Gothic architecture, every turn feels like stepping into a storybook.
Since the Velvet Revolution of 1989, Prague has opened its arms to the world — yet it remains surprisingly affordable. A hearty local meal can cost less than INR 850 per person, making it perfect for couples who want luxury experiences at budget-friendly prices.
Romantic Things to Do in Prague
1. Sunrise at Charles Bridge
Start your day early and walk hand-in-hand across the famous Charles Bridge as the first light glows over the Vltava River. Don’t forget to make a wish at the statue of St. John of Nepomuk.
2. Sunset River Cruise
Drift along the Vltava with a glass of wine in hand, watching Prague’s skyline transform in golden light.
3. Medieval Dinner Experience
Step back in time with a five-course medieval feast, complete with candlelight, live music, belly dancers, and swordsmen — an unforgettable date night!
4. Private Walking Tours
Discover hidden courtyards, tucked-away cafés, and the city’s best-kept secrets with a private guide.

Kyoto, Japan
With its delicate balance of centuries-old traditions and serene landscapes, Kyoto feels like it was designed for romance. Honeymooners are swept away by its tranquil gardens, sacred temples, and the gentle pace of life that makes every moment feel intimate.
Kyoto Honeymoon Highlights
Known as Japan’s cultural capital, Kyoto invites couples on a journey through the country’s elegant past.
-
Historic Temples & Shrines – Explore UNESCO-listed sites like Kiyomizu-dera and Fushimi Inari Taisha, where vermillion gates create dreamy photo backdrops.
-
Romantic Gardens – Lose yourselves in the peaceful beauty of Ryoan-ji’s Zen rock garden or the seasonal blooms of Kyoto Botanical Gardens.
-
Walkable City – Its compact layout makes it easy to discover hidden tea houses, artisan shops, and quiet backstreets on foot or by bicycle.
This former imperial capital blends timeless elegance with just enough modern comfort to make it the perfect setting for newlyweds.
Romantic Things to Do in Kyoto
1. Stay in a Traditional Ryokan
Experience Japanese hospitality at its finest with sliding shoji doors, tatami mat floors, private gardens, and multi-course kaiseki dinners.
2. Rent a Machiya
These beautifully preserved wooden townhouses give you complete privacy while surrounding you with authentic Kyoto charm.
3. Stroll Through Gion at Dusk
Wander the lantern-lit lanes of this historic geisha district, where you may spot a geiko (Kyoto’s geisha) on her way to an evening appointment.
4. Seasonal Magic
Visit in spring for romantic cherry blossom walks or in autumn for fiery red maple leaves framing temple views.
Best Time to Visit Kyoto for a Honeymoon
-
Spring (March–May) – Mild weather (10°C–20°C) and breathtaking cherry blossoms.
-
Autumn (October–November) – Crisp air and vibrant fall foliage that turns the city into a painting.
-
Winter (December–February) – Quiet, peaceful streets and snow-kissed temples for a truly magical experience.
